Company History – How Zoot Built Its Furniture Legacy

Ever wonder how a small UK workshop grew into a go‑to source for classroom desks and office chairs? It all started when a group of designers decided that schools needed furniture that could last, look good, and support learning. They set up a modest workshop, tested wood strength with real teachers, and promised to keep prices honest.

Fast forward a decade, Zoot now ships ergonomic desks, stackable chairs, and smart storage to schools across the country. The secret? Listening to educators, using durable materials, and constantly tweaking designs based on feedback. Every new product line carries a bit of that original mission – comfort, durability, and style for learning spaces.

Our Journey in Numbers

Since 2012 we’ve installed over 15,000 desks in primary schools, reduced chair breakage rates by 30% with reinforced frames, and saved schools an average of £200 per classroom through bulk pricing. Those stats aren’t just bragging; they guide the advice you’ll find in our articles. When we write about “how often to replace home furniture,” the tips are rooted in real‑world data from our own product lifespans.
